The Shelly 1 Mini Gen4 measures only 29 x 34 x 16 mm, making it suitable for almost any flush-mounted box. The device switches lighting or other electrical appliances up to 8A via a potential-free relay, and supports WiFi, Zigbee and Matter in one module.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ch2\u003ePower supply and connectivity\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e module operates on 110-240V AC (50\/60 Hz) and requires a neutral wire (blue N-wire). If this is missing behind your switch, the Shelly 1 Mini Gen4 is not suitable for that location. Wireless protocols: WiFi 802.11 b\/g\/n (2.4 GHz), Bluetooth 5.0 and Zigbee IEEE 802.15.4. Matter certification is present. The module also functions as a WiFi range extender and Bluetooth Gateway.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ch2\u003eFunctionality and settings\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e device has one potential-free relay contact. There is no built-in power measurement; for consumption monitoring per switch, the \u003ca href=\"\/en\/collections\/shelly\" title=\"Shelly 1PM Mini Gen4 with energy measurement\"\u003eShelly 1PM Mini Gen4\u003c\/a\u003e is the right choice. The module supports 20 adjustable schedules, webhooks, scripting, MQTT and KNX net\/IP. OTA firmware updates are done automatically via the Shelly Smart Control app or local web interface.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e⚠️ Pay attention to inductive loads such as LED drivers and fans: the inrush current can damage the relay. Use an RC snubber to dampen this inrush current.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ch2\u003eExpansion and accessories\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e Shelly 1 Mini Gen4 combines well with a \u003ca href=\"\/en\/collections\/draadloze-schakelaars\" title=\"Wireless switches for smart home\"\u003ewireless switch\u003c\/a\u003e for wall control without additional wiring. As a Zigbee repeater, the module directly increases the wireless range in the room where it is installed, provided it is connected to mains power.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ch2\u003eHome Assistant\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eIn the standard WiFi\/Matter mode, you use the official \u003ca href=\"https:\/\/www.home-assistant.io\/integrations\/shelly\/\" title=\"Shelly integration Home Assistant\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\" target=\"_blank\"\u003eShelly integration in Home Assistant\u003c\/a\u003e for local, cloud-independent control via the RPC protocol. For Zigbee, you need a \u003ca title=\"Zigbee coordinator for Home Assistant\" href=\"\/en\/collections\/smart-home-usb-controller?sort_by=best-selling\u0026amp;filter.p.m.custom.protocol=Zigbee\"\u003eZigbee coordinator\u003c\/a\u003e. For Matter, a Matter-compatible controller is required.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eIs a neutral wire mandatory?\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eYes. The Shelly 1 Mini Gen4 requires a neutral wire (blue N-wire) behind the switch. If this wire is missing in your installation, this device is not suitable. Check this in advance or consult an electrician.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eHow do I pair the module with Home Assistant?\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eIn WiFi mode, Home Assistant automatically detects the device via the Shelly integration (Settings \u0026gt; Devices \u0026amp; services). In Zigbee mode, you first switch to Zigbee firmware via the Shelly Smart Control app, after which you pair via ZHA or Zigbee2MQTT.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eCan I use WiFi and Zigbee simultaneously?\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eNo. The module switches between Matter mode (with WiFi) and Zigbee mode via a firmware switch. Both are not active simultaneously. Choose the mode that suits your home automation infrastructure.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eDoes the Shelly 1 Mini Gen4 measure power consumption?\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eNo. The 1 Mini Gen4 has no built-in energy measurement. If you want to track consumption per switch, choose the \u003ca title=\"Shelly 1PM Mini Gen4 with power measurement\" href=\"\/en\/collections\/shelly\"\u003eShelly 1PM Mini Gen4\u003c\/a\u003e, which does include power measurement.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eDoes the module work as a Zigbee repeater?\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eYes. Because the module works continuously on mains power, it functions as a Router (repeater) in Zigbee mode and strengthens the range of other Zigbee end devices in your network.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eWhich loads are suitable?\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e device switches up to 8A AC. For inductive loads such as LED drivers, motors and fans, an RC snubber is required to dampen the inrush current and protect the relay.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eReady for installation in an hour.
